Ole Miss men’s basketball team spent last week north of the border on a Canadian tour. Coach Kermit Davis sat down with the media on Monday to discuss what the team learned on the trip.
The Rebels returned with a 3-1 record, and the only loss came to Carleton. Coach Davis’ squad did overcome adversity coming back from a 10-point deficit at the half against Concordia with the use of a 1-3-1 zone.
Among the new faces in a Rebel uniform, Blake Hinson and KJ Buffen played heavy minutes as they each subbed for one another.
“Our 1-3-1 and our man packages are really simple right now,” Davis said. “So, over the next 60 days when we get back through individual work and team practice we have got to get better.”
Ole Miss will officially start practice for the upcoming season Oct. 1.
